สร้างคำอธิบายประกอบ PDF ด้วย GroupDocs.Annotation สำหรับ Java: คู่มือฉบับสมบูรณ์

การแนะนำ

ในยุคดิจิทัลทุกวันนี้ การจัดการและใส่คำอธิบายประกอบเอกสารอย่างมีประสิทธิภาพถือเป็นสิ่งสำคัญสำหรับผู้เชี่ยวชาญในอุตสาหกรรมต่างๆ ไม่ว่าคุณจะเป็นนักพัฒนาที่ต้องการผสานการจัดการเอกสารเข้ากับแอปพลิเคชันของคุณ หรือเป็นผู้ใช้ปลายทางที่ต้องการใส่คำอธิบายประกอบอย่างรวดเร็วในไฟล์ PDF ที่สำคัญ GroupDocs.Annotation สำหรับ Java ก็มีโซลูชันอันทรงพลังให้คุณ บทช่วยสอนนี้จะแนะนำคุณตลอดการโหลด PDF จากดิสก์ในเครื่องและเพิ่มคำอธิบายประกอบโดยใช้ GroupDocs.Annotation

สิ่งที่คุณจะได้เรียนรู้:

  • การตั้งค่า GroupDocs.Annotation สำหรับ Java
  • การโหลดเอกสารจากเส้นทางไฟล์ภายในเครื่อง
  • การเพิ่มคำอธิบายพื้นที่ลงในเอกสารของคุณ
  • บันทึกไฟล์ที่มีคำอธิบายได้อย่างง่ายดาย

ก่อนที่จะเริ่ม มาดูข้อกำหนดเบื้องต้นที่คุณจำเป็นต้องมีกันก่อน

ข้อกำหนดเบื้องต้น

หากต้องการปฏิบัติตามบทช่วยสอนนี้อย่างมีประสิทธิผล ให้แน่ใจว่าคุณมีสิ่งต่อไปนี้:

ไลบรารีและสิ่งที่ต้องพึ่งพา:

  • GroupDocs.Annotation สำหรับ Java เวอร์ชัน 25.2
  • ไลบรารี Apache Commons IO สำหรับการจัดการไฟล์

ข้อกำหนดการตั้งค่าสภาพแวดล้อม:

  • ติดตั้ง JDK บนระบบของคุณ (แนะนำ Java 8 หรือใหม่กว่า)
  • IDE เช่น IntelliJ IDEA หรือ Eclipse สำหรับการเขียนและรันโค้ดของคุณ

ข้อกำหนดเบื้องต้นของความรู้:

  • ความเข้าใจพื้นฐานเกี่ยวกับการเขียนโปรแกรมภาษา Java
  • ความคุ้นเคยกับการตั้งค่าโครงการ Maven จะเป็นประโยชน์

การตั้งค่า GroupDocs.Annotation สำหรับ Java

หากต้องการเริ่มใช้ GroupDocs.Annotation คุณต้องตั้งค่าไลบรารีในโปรเจ็กต์ Java ของคุณก่อน นี่คือวิธีที่คุณสามารถทำได้โดยใช้ Maven:

การตั้งค่า Maven

เพิ่มที่เก็บข้อมูลและการอ้างอิงต่อไปนี้ให้กับคุณ pom.xml ไฟล์:

<repositories>
   <repository>
      <id>repository.groupdocs.com</id>
      <name>GroupDocs Repository</name>
      <url>https://releases.groupdocs.com/annotation/java/</url>
   </repository>
</repositories>

<dependencies>
   <dependency>
      <groupId>com.groupdocs</groupId>
      <artifactId>groupdocs-annotation</artifactId>
      <version>25.2</version>
   </dependency>
</dependencies>

ขั้นตอนการรับใบอนุญาต

คุณสามารถเริ่มต้นด้วยการทดลองใช้ฟรีเพื่อทดสอบคุณลักษณะของ GroupDocs.Annotation:

  1. ทดลองใช้งานฟรี: ดาวน์โหลดเวอร์ชันทดลองใช้ได้จาก ที่นี่.
  2. ใบอนุญาตชั่วคราว: ขอใบอนุญาตชั่วคราวเพื่อการทดสอบขยายเวลาโดยมาเยี่ยมชม ลิงค์นี้.
  3. ซื้อ: สำหรับการใช้งานการผลิต ให้ซื้อใบอนุญาตเต็มรูปแบบได้ที่ หน้าการซื้อ GroupDocs.

การเริ่มต้นและการตั้งค่าเบื้องต้น

เมื่อคุณตั้งค่าไลบรารีในโครงการของคุณแล้ว ให้เริ่มต้น GroupDocs.Annotation ดังต่อไปนี้:

import com.groupdocs.annotation.Annotator;

// เริ่มต้น Annotator ด้วยเส้นทางไปยังเอกสารของคุณ
final Annotator annotator = new Annotator("YOUR_DOCUMENT_DIRECTORY/input.pdf");

คู่มือการใช้งาน

ตอนนี้คุณได้ตั้งค่าทุกอย่างเรียบร้อยแล้ว มาเริ่มการใช้งานฟีเจอร์คำอธิบายประกอบกันเลย

การโหลดเอกสารจากดิสก์ภายในเครื่อง

ภาพรวม

เริ่มต้นด้วยการโหลดไฟล์ PDF จากดิสก์ภายในเครื่องของคุณ ซึ่งเป็นสิ่งสำคัญสำหรับการเปิดใช้งานคำอธิบายประกอบในเอกสาร

ขั้นตอนที่ 1: ระบุเส้นทางไฟล์

กำหนดเส้นทางไปยังไฟล์อินพุตและเอาต์พุตของคุณ:

String INPUT_PDF = "YOUR_DOCUMENT_DIRECTORY/input.pdf";
String outputPath = "YOUR_OUTPUT_DIRECTORY/output_annotated.pdf";

การเพิ่มคำอธิบายประกอบ

ภาพรวม

ที่นี่เราจะเพิ่มคำอธิบายพื้นที่แบบง่าย ๆ ลงในเอกสารที่โหลด

ขั้นตอนที่ 1: สร้างและกำหนดค่า AreaAnnotation
import com.groupdocs.annotation.models.Rectangle;
import com.groupdocs.annotation.models.annotationmodels.AreaAnnotation;

// เริ่มต้น AreaAnnotation
AreaAnnotation area = new AreaAnnotation();

// กำหนดตำแหน่ง (x, y) และขนาด (ความกว้าง, ความสูง) ของคำอธิบายประกอบ
area.setBox(new Rectangle(100, 100, 100, 100));

// ตั้งค่าสีพื้นหลังเป็นรูปแบบ ARGB ในที่นี้ตั้งค่าเป็นสีเหลือง
area.setBackgroundColor(65535);
ขั้นตอนที่ 2: เพิ่มคำอธิบายลงในเอกสาร
annotator.add(area); // เพิ่มคำอธิบายพื้นที่ลงในเอกสารของคุณ

การบันทึกไฟล์ที่มีคำอธิบายประกอบ

ภาพรวม

หลังจากเพิ่มคำอธิบายแล้ว ให้บันทึก PDF ที่มีคำอธิบายลงในตำแหน่งที่ระบุ

// บันทึกเอกสารที่มีคำอธิบายประกอบ
annotator.save(outputPath);

// ปล่อยทรัพยากร
annotator.dispose();

เคล็ดลับการแก้ไขปัญหา:

  • ตรวจสอบให้แน่ใจว่าเส้นทางไฟล์ถูกต้องและสามารถเข้าถึงได้
  • ตรวจสอบสิทธิ์การอ่าน/เขียนที่จำเป็นบนดิสก์ภายในเครื่องของคุณ

การประยุกต์ใช้งานจริง

ต่อไปนี้คือสถานการณ์จริงบางสถานการณ์ที่ GroupDocs.Annotation สามารถมีประโยชน์อย่างยิ่งได้:

  1. การตรวจสอบเอกสารทางกฎหมาย: อธิบายสัญญาอย่างรวดเร็วด้วยความคิดเห็นหรือไฮไลต์ก่อนที่จะสรุปสัญญา
  2. ความร่วมมือทางวิชาการ: แบ่งปัน PDF ที่มีคำอธิบายประกอบระหว่างนักเรียนและอาจารย์เพื่อรับคำติชมและการแก้ไข
  3. ข้อเสนอแนะข้อเสนอทางธุรกิจ: อำนวยความสะดวกในการแก้ไขร่วมกันบนข้อเสนอทางธุรกิจโดยเน้นประเด็นสำคัญ

การพิจารณาประสิทธิภาพ

การเพิ่มประสิทธิภาพการทำงานเมื่อใช้ GroupDocs.Annotation ใน Java เป็นสิ่งสำคัญ:

  • การจัดการทรัพยากร: โทรมาได้ตลอดเวลา annotator.dispose() เพื่อปลดปล่อยทรัพยากรเมื่อคุณเสร็จสิ้นงานคำอธิบายประกอบ
  • การใช้หน่วยความจำ: ตรวจสอบการใช้หน่วยความจำของแอปพลิเคชันของคุณ โดยเฉพาะอย่างยิ่งเมื่อต้องจัดการกับเอกสารขนาดใหญ่

บทสรุป

ตอนนี้คุณได้เรียนรู้วิธีการใส่คำอธิบายประกอบใน PDF โดยใช้ GroupDocs.Annotation สำหรับ Java แล้ว คู่มือนี้ครอบคลุมถึงการตั้งค่าไลบรารี การโหลดเอกสาร การเพิ่มคำอธิบายประกอบ และการบันทึกไฟล์ หากต้องการศึกษาความสามารถของ GroupDocs.Annotation เพิ่มเติม โปรดพิจารณาการผสานรวมเข้ากับแอปพลิเคชันเว็บหรือทำให้การทำงานด้านคำอธิบายประกอบในโครงการของคุณเป็นแบบอัตโนมัติ

ขั้นตอนต่อไป:

  • ทดลองใช้ประเภทคำอธิบายที่แตกต่างกัน
  • สำรวจการบูรณาการ GroupDocs.Annotation เข้ากับเครื่องมือการจัดการเอกสารอื่น

พร้อมที่จะเริ่มใส่คำอธิบายประกอบหรือยัง ลองใช้โซลูชันนี้แล้วดูว่าจะช่วยเพิ่มประสิทธิภาพเวิร์กโฟลว์ของคุณได้อย่างไร

ส่วนคำถามที่พบบ่อย

  1. ฉันจะเพิ่มคำอธิบายประกอบหลายรายการลงใน PDF เดียวได้อย่างไร

    • เพียงแค่ทำซ้ำ annotator.add(annotation) วิธีการสำหรับแต่ละประเภทคำอธิบายประกอบที่คุณต้องการเพิ่ม
  2. GroupDocs.Annotation สามารถจัดการไฟล์ประเภทอื่นนอกเหนือจาก PDF ได้หรือไม่

    • ใช่ รองรับรูปแบบต่างๆ เช่น เอกสาร Word และรูปภาพ ตรวจสอบ เอกสารอ้างอิง API สำหรับรายละเอียดเพิ่มเติม
  3. แนวทางปฏิบัติที่ดีที่สุดในการจัดการใบอนุญาตในสภาพแวดล้อมการผลิตคืออะไร

    • ตรวจสอบให้แน่ใจว่าใบอนุญาตของคุณถูกต้องและได้รับการต่ออายุตามความจำเป็นเพื่อหลีกเลี่ยงการหยุดชะงักของบริการ
  4. ฉันสามารถใส่คำอธิบายประกอบใน PDF ที่เก็บไว้บนที่เก็บข้อมูลบนคลาวด์โดยใช้ GroupDocs.Annotation ได้หรือไม่

    • ใช่ ด้วยการกำหนดค่าที่เหมาะสม คุณสามารถขยายฟังก์ชันการทำงานเพื่อทำงานกับไฟล์บนคลาวด์ได้
  5. ฉันควรดำเนินการแก้ไขปัญหาอย่างไรหากคำอธิบายประกอบไม่ปรากฏขึ้นอย่างถูกต้อง?

    • ตรวจสอบพิกัดและขนาดในของคุณ Rectangle วัตถุ ตรวจสอบให้แน่ใจว่าเส้นทางไฟล์ถูกต้อง และตรวจสอบการอัปเดตไลบรารี

ทรัพยากร